Formatted to 32-bit words:

45000027 IPV4 Header
617D0000
4011D481 SubProtocol: 0x11=UDP
0C000260 Source IP: 12.0.2.96 (Radio ID: x.x.2.96 = x.x.0x02.0x60 = 0x0260 = 608)
0D002968 Destination IP: 13.0.41.104 (Location Server: x.x.41.104 = x.x.0x29.0x68 = 0x2968 = 10600)
0FA10FA1 Source Port: 4001, Destination Port: 4001

0013114907096640151A3304E20CF3 UDP Payload

00131149070966 40151A33 04E20CF3

latitude = 0x40151A33 = 1075124787 * (180/0xFFFFFFFF) = 45.0579593203N
longitude =  0x04E20CF3 =   81923315 * (360/0xFFFFFFFF) = 6.86673293981E
